We are proud to share that our work with both the Kirkland Ranch Academy of Innovation (KRAI) and the Western Michigan University's Student Center have received recognition as part of the 2024 Chicago Athenaeum International Architecture Awards program.

The International Architecture Awards honors the best, significant new buildings, landscape architecture and planning projects designed and/or built around the world annually.

Our KRAI project earned an official award while the WMU Student Center earned a spot on this year's honorable mention list. Here's more about each project.

The Kirkland Ranch Academy of Innovation is a vessel of impact for students and the local Florida economy we created in partnership with Pasco County Schools and Hepner Architects.

Focusing on Career and Technical Education (CTE), the school offers hands-on, interactive learning that teaches skills more than theory—equipping students with the competencies needed to successfully transition from high school to careers, or into college and beyond.

Showcasing strategic siting and stunning architecture, the project features various internal and external spaces engineered to foster community, collaboration and safety.

Western Michigan University Student Center

The new Student Center at Western Michigan University is a beacon of inclusion. Located on lands historically occupied by Ojibwe, Odawa and Bodewadmi nations, the building is designed to be a student-centered gathering place that champions belonging and honors the roots of Native American heritage embedded throughout the site.  

Replacing the Bernhard Center, the new vibrant space is intended to serve as the hub of belonging, fostering connection, community and collaboration for all students. The three-level building features gathering and lounge spaces, a dining facility, the campus bookstore, an anticipated on-campus brewpub, the campus welcome center and retail locations. It also features a grand ballroom, conferencing spaces and a game room, while dotting collaboration zones throughout.
